Transaction 528a680ddccd4200e05f2f1c336cd081c34cfe8ebf573b11585397b5cf83970e

2 Input
2 Outputs
  • 528a680ddccd4200e05f2f1c336cd081c34cfe8ebf573b11585397b5cf83970e:0
  • value  1254511
    address  1Kgu7tDX5yArpUVmXadAd33UUEQUBLaKYm
  • 528a680ddccd4200e05f2f1c336cd081c34cfe8ebf573b11585397b5cf83970e:1
  • value  4871570
    address  1MBbHySdff6cMBRgcHMrdoyMqGJqzPe3nK